[Unseparated, Unmixed. Special Services in the Coexistence of Judaism, Christianity and Islam].
In a religiously pluralistic society, requests for interfaith ceremonies are increasingly part of everyday church life. Weddings, funerals, dedications or event-related prayers in which more than one religion is involved present liturgical and theological challenges. This book aims to outline ways in which pastors can act in uncertain terrain. It is intended to sharpen awareness and pass on accumulated experience – in the sense of a workbook. The drafts are the result of several years of discussions between the VELKD Institute for Liturgical Studies in Leipzig and the House of One in Berlin. The individual liturgical suggestions are accompanied by reflective introductions and a number of essays dealing with theological questions on interreligious prayer.
